The Golden Age of Gaming, is it Over?
More like Resident Evil: Bore.
I have noticed that while video games are becoming increasingly appealing to the senses, it also seems that they are also becoming more linear and full of mindless action. For example, Resident Evil: 4 was just that - a boring mistake of an action game. It took everything that made the Resident Evil series great (non-linear, adventure-based gameplay) and threw it into the trash. Am I destined to watch all my favorite games turn intop mindless shooter? Is the "Golden Age" of games over only to be replaced by beautiful-but-empty games designed to cater to gamers who demand nothing more than zombies wielding rocket launchers?
Any opinions?

The official "Golden Age of Gaming" ended in the mid 80s. The second generation of gaming is considered the golden age. We are on the seventh now. This website is dedicated to the third and fourth generations which are the ones I grew up with.

I wouldn't consider this a spam/junk thread.
I voted "Worse" because I honestly believe game quality is declining nowdays. That could be because I'm an old man. SO you know, "GET OFF MY LAWN!".
Also, I disagree with what you said about the beginnings of Resident Evil. That first game was Linear in my opinion. You could explore the mansion but stuff was always in the same places, no real choices besides how to shoot those zombies. Not to mention the horribly awkward controls and camera angles. But, that one hallway you enter where the zombie dogs jump in the window stayed with me. Scared me.
Just wait for the Wii to come out with some more games. I have a feeling the system is gonna revitalize the gaming industry. At least I hope so.
